ROMEOVILLE, Ill. – State Rep. John Connor, D-Lockport, will host a self-defense seminar for women with the Illinois State Police on Monday, June 18 at 6 p.m. at the Romeoville Recreation Center, located at 900 W. Romeo Rd.

“As a former prosecutor, I know that no matter how cautious we are, it is always possible to become a victim of crime,” Connor said. “Violence can happen anywhere and affect anyone, but being prepared and educated on how to defend yourself can help in getting out of a difficult situation. I hope that this seminar will help women learn useful skills to protect themselves in any predicament.”

Self-defense skills will be taught by a trained law enforcement officer from the Illinois State Police. The seminar will be interactive, and will provide introductory techniques on how to protect oneself from assailants. The event is free and open to the public, but women who plan to attend are encouraged to RSVP by contacting Connor’s office at 815-372-0085.

“While I hope the skills learned at this event are never needed, it is critical that women know how to protect themselves in dangerous situations,” Connor said. “I’m also grateful to the Illinois State Police for taking the time to share these useful tips with residents in our community.”
